Approximately twice as many analysts consistently provided competition support (62%; pre- or post-competition) compared to training (35%), inferring a greater competition focus. Conversely, a jackal (a player on the defending team competing for the ball using his hands after a tackle was made but prior to the formation of a ruck) was the most effective strategy in the central field areas. Rugby performance analysis continues to rely heavily on isolated measures of performance, such as performance indicators, without providing context to confounding factors such as opposition behaviour, pitch location, period within match and venue location. Similarly, pitch location and the timing of ruck strategies influenced the outcome of ball possession in the 2011 Super Rugby competition [15]. However, isolated performance indicators do not consider the opposition, nor do they account for unpredictability and inherent match specificity. In summary, studies of performance analysis in rugby often show methodological shortcomings regarding the genesis of performance indicators and selection process, a lack of transparency and operational definitions with the investigated performance indicators and issues related to investigating performance indicators over entire competitions. The SPORTDiscus electronic database was searched on 8 March 2019 for relevant articles published between 1 January 1997 and 7 March 2019 using the following search terms: Rugby AND collective behav* OR tactic* analysis OR tactic* performance OR tactical indicator* OR performance indicator* OR performance analysis OR notational analysis OR game analysis OR observational analysis OR Pattern* of play OR dynamic* system OR tactic* behave* OR neural network OR system* think* OR performance model* OR player selection OR player evaluation OR game statistics. Between 2004 and 2007, winning teams won more lineouts on the opposition's throw, scored more tries, had greater metres gained, kicks out of hand, line breaks and percentage tackles made in international, Super Rugby and professional domestic competitions [17, 22, 23].
